Qualifications:  
High school diploma or G.E.D. required with a preference towards individuals with prior money handling and customer service experience. Candidates must pass background and drug screening per Kaw Nation Gaming Commission regulations to obtain a gaming license (Medical Marijuana cards are accepted). Flexibility to work any shift as needed or assigned—including weekends, evenings, and holidays—is required.

Responsibilities and Duties:
The Slot Technician is responsible for performing advanced repairs and coordinating with vendors for machines requiring specialized service or maintenance beyond internal capabilities. They assist guests by answering questions about gameplay, troubleshoot machine malfunctions, and help maintain a safe gaming environment by monitoring for suspicious activity on the casino floor.
           
  • Assist guests and direct them to the locations of requested machines.
  • Ensure slot machines are functioning properly by addressing malfunctions, clearing paper or money jams, refilling printer paper, and assisting with stuck tickets.
  • Coordinate with internal teams and external vendors to ensure timely and effective machine repairs.
  • Maintain the back-of-house system by keeping components clean, organized, and fully operational.
  • Assist with the installation and removal of slot machines.
  • Maintain a professional appearance and demeanor while conducting company business.
  • Follow all applicable state, federal, and tribal laws, regulations, and compliance requirements.
